In new work published online September 14 in
Nature Communications, they are the first to show that the speed
at which the epigenome changes with
age is associated with lifespan across species and that calorie restriction slows this process of change, potentially explaining its effects on longevity.

New research published today in
Nature Geoscience by Richard Zeebe, professor
at the University of Hawai'i — Mānoa School of Ocean and Earth Science and Technology (SOEST), and colleagues looks
at changes of Earth's temperature and atmospheric carbon dioxide (CO2) since the end of the
age of the dinosaurs.

The researchers, who published their work online November 5 in
Nature, are now investigating just how long the improvement might last and how deep sleep affects memory — for some reason, humans begin to lose the ability to sleep deeply around 40 years of
age,
at about the same time that memory begins to decline.
